Replacing a roof in Virginia Beach is a wind-and-water job first and a curb-appeal job second. Hampton Roads sits in a high-wind coastal zone that sees nor’easters, tropical systems, and wind-driven rain, so the details that decide how long a roof lasts here — the underlayment, the nailing pattern, the drip edge and ice-and-water shield, and the wind rating of the shingle — matter more than the color. Roof Replacement cost in Virginia Beach by scope

Virginia Beach roof replacement pricing is driven by roof size (in “squares” of 100 sq ft), pitch/complexity, and material. Use these typical local all-in ranges (tear-off, underlayment, material, and labor) to sanity-check bids:

ScopeTypical Virginia Beach range
Architectural asphalt shingle (most VB homes; 3D dimensional shingle, full tear-off, ~18–26 squares)$9,000 – $18,000
Premium / designer asphalt (impact- or high-wind-rated designer shingle, or a larger/steep/complex roof)$16,000 – $28,000
Standing-seam metal (coastal-grade metal; longest life, best wind performance)$22,000 – $45,000+
Low-slope / flat section (add) (TPO or modified-bitumen membrane over porches/additions)$8 – $14 / sq ft

How a roof replacement works in Virginia Beach, start to finish

  1. Post the job & compare bids1–2 weeks — describe the roof (size, pitch, material, any leaks or storm damage) on BidBro, compare competing bids on price, material, and warranty, and verify each roofer’s DPOR license and insurance.
  2. Permit & material order3–10 days — the roofer pulls the Virginia Beach re-roof permit and orders shingles/metal (color and high-wind lines can carry a short lead time).
  3. Tear-off & deck inspection1 day — old roofing is stripped to the deck, and any rotten plywood is replaced before the new system goes on (the reason a bid should carry a per-sheet allowance).
  4. Underlayment, flashing & shingles1–3 days — ice-and-water shield, synthetic underlayment, drip edge, new flashing, and the new roof installed to the manufacturer’s high-wind spec; most VB homes are a 1–2 day install.
  5. Cleanup & final inspection1 day — magnetic nail sweep of the yard, haul-off, and the city final inspection that closes the permit.

Timelines are typical for Virginia Beach; permitting and material lead times are the biggest variables.

Do I need a permit to replace a roof in Virginia Beach?

Yes. A full roof replacement requires a building permit and a final inspection from the Virginia Beach Permits and Inspections Division at the Municipal Center (2405 Courthouse Drive) — unlike a small repair, a re-roof is permitted work. A licensed roofer pulls the permit in their name; confirm that is included in the bid rather than left to you.

What roof holds up best on the Virginia Beach coast?

For most Virginia Beach homes, a high-wind-rated architectural asphalt shingle (110–130 mph) with a six-nail pattern, ice-and-water shield, and proper drip edge is the value sweet spot. Standing-seam metal costs more up front but delivers the longest life and the best wind and salt-air performance, which is why it is popular near the Oceanfront and Sandbridge. The install details matter as much as the material — make sure competing bids spell out the nailing and underlayment.

How long does a roof replacement take in Virginia Beach?

Most Virginia Beach asphalt re-roofs are a 1–2 day install once materials are on site, with a few days for the permit and order beforehand and a final inspection after. Metal, steep, or complex roofs take longer. Weather is the main variable on the coast — a good roofer will not tear off more than they can dry-in the same day during storm season.
